Glasgow Airport Security Staff Strike Could Hit Scotland World Cup Passengers

Unite said around 170 ICTS workers rejected an unacceptable offer, and strike action could disrupt summer holiday passengers if the ballot passes.

Summary by Glasgow Live
The Unite union said 170 security staff at the airport were to be balloted over potential summer strike action which could also impact the Glasgow 2026 Commonwealth Games.
